Claysville
Claysville is wealthier than most US places, with a median household income of $78,906. Population has held roughly steady since 2000. Median home value has risen by half since 2000, reaching $118,100.

How many people live in Claysville, Pennsylvania?
Claysville, Pennsylvania has about 733 residents according to the 2020 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in Claysville, Pennsylvania?
The typical household in Claysville, Pennsylvania earns about $78,906 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Claysville, Pennsylvania expensive?
In Claysville, Pennsylvania, the median home is worth about $118,100, and the typical rent is about $613 a month.
How educated are people in Claysville, Pennsylvania?
About 27.3% of adults age 25 and over in Claysville, Pennsylvania h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Claysville, Pennsylvania?
About 9.3% of people in Claysville, Pennsylvania live below the federal poverty line.
